Fifties inspiration for Olga Peretyatko

One of the first appointments which has opened this summer opera season, although with some difficulties, is the Aix en Provence Festival. This year, one of the productions is G. Rossini’s “Il Turco in Italia”, featuring a cast of Rossini-expert singers, among whom the diva Olga Peretyatko. Inspired by the costumes created for Fiorilla (her role in the opera), the Russian soprano has opted for a refined, 1950s style: sheath dresses, pumps, hairstyle with bangs.

Here she is in front of her dressing room at the Théâtre de l’Archevêché, after the dress rehearsal. Her dress is by Prada – a black and white checked sheath dress, with v-neckline, big buttons on the front and thin belt, paired to black pumps.

On July 7, after the performance, she posed in her dressing room wearing a sheath dress by the American designer Zac Posen, characterized by a floral/geometric pattern and a plunging neckline, accessorized with silver open-toe pumps. Femininity with a touch of originality!
